6 facing charges after Saskatoon police seize loaded guns, marijuana

Six people are facing numerous weapon and drug-related charges after police executed two searches in Saskatoon.

Saskatoon police say they executed two searches on Friday and now six people are facing numerous weapon and drug-related charges.

The searches were undertaken by the guns and gangs unit with the assistance of patrol officers early Friday morning. One search was in the 600-block of Duchess Street and the other in the 100-block of Meadows Boulevard.

Officers seized a loaded semi-automatic rifle, a loaded handgun, a can of bear spray, over 2.5 kilograms of cannabis marijuana and over $14,000.

Two 19-year-old men, three 16-year-old boys and a 15-year-old boy are facing charges that include trafficking in a controlled substance, unlawful possession of a firearm, and proceeds of crime.

The accused were expected to appear before a justice of the peace Friday evening.

The matter remains under investigation.
